Sub-series
Multiple Projects
CP138.S6.D21
Description:
File consists of films and videos which combine multiple projects of Gordon Matta-Clark together on one support. Materials were recorded in 1971, 1974-1977, and were transferred to videocassettes1991-1992 and to film reels at an unknown date. File contains film reels and videocassettes.
transferred to videocassette 1991-1992 (originally created 1971, [1974-1977])

Sub-series
Projects
AP165.S5.SS2
Description:
The Projects sub-series, circa 1990 – 2000, consists of 61 video recordings relating to specific works in transformable design completed by Hoberman in the early years of his career. Material consists of MiniDV cassettes, Betacam SP cassettes, DVCAM cassettes, and Hi-8 cassettes. The majority of the records date from the mid to late 90’s to early 2000’s. Video recordings in this sub-series document projects such as: 6-meter expanding sphere as a permanent central exhibit at the Liberty Science Center, Jersey City, USA, 1991; Working scale model and section of a 60-foot diameter Iris Dome at The Museum of Modern Art, New York City, USA 1994; expanding sphere as a permanent atrium sculpture at Otaru Bay City Center, Sapporo, Japan 1998; six 2-meter diameter expanding spheres at Museo Interactivo Mirador, Santiago, Chile 1999; retractable dome for World’s Fair installed in front of the German Pavilion Expo 2000 World’s Fair, Hannover, Germany, 2000; 72-foot diameter retractable arch for Olympics Medal Plaza at 2002 Olympic Winter Games Salt Lake City, USA, 2002. It also contains footage of Hoberman and his team assembling works at his studio in New York.
circa 1990-2002

Sub-series
Programs
CP138.S6.D24
Description:
File includes compilations made from Gordon Matta-Clark's original films and videos, and organized into a series of roughly hour long programmes for reproduction and distribution by Electronic Arts Intermix. Materials were recorded between 1971 and 1977 and transferred to videocassette in 1993. File contains videocassettes.
transferred to videocassette 1993 (originally created 1971-1977)

Project
Senna [Seine] (2002)
AP207.S1.2002.PR02
Description:
The project series documents the film "Senna", produced by Pettena in 2002. The film shows Pettena descending down the stairs towards the Seine river, in Paris, and eventually disappear. "Here Pettena returns to the theme of the architectural project developed in the form of a performance that uses the body to produce an effect of working of space poised between the real and the imaginary." [1] The project series contains video of the performance and film stills. Source: [1] Gianni Pettena website, https://www.giannipettena.it/italiano/opere-1/ff-seine-2002/ (last accessed 22 January 2020).
